Why Ram Parameswaran Says the World's Biggest Tech Stocks Are Ridiculously Cheap Right Now
Ram Parameswaran, Founder and CIO at Octahedron Capital, explains why the world's biggest tech stocks are undervalued despite regulatory challenges, exploring post-pandemic consumer behavior trends, the growth of the on-demand economy, and strategic investment opportunities in a shifting global tech landscape.
